Pork is a bit unique, hogs go to market well before they reach full adult size, and at the time when they go they are still growing rapidly. Beef grow slower and hold at a market weight longer, chicken are still growing very fast when they get to market, but they are only 8-10 weeks old, so the turnover is fast.Monkey Driven, Call this Living?0 -

F Me In The Brain said:What happens if they continue to grow...is the meat no longer good?
The biggest problem, and the reason they euthanize, is that pork slaughter/processing machinery isn't designed to handle swine larger than 300lbs.Monkey Driven, Call this Living?0 -
